Glycol-Based Deicing Solutions Price Trend in Past Five Years and Factors Impacting Price Movements  

Between 2020 and 2025, the price of Glycol-Based Deicing Solutions has fluctuated due to several global and regional factors. In 2020, the average global price hovered around $950/MT, influenced by steady raw material availability and relatively moderate winters in key markets. However, prices started to climb in 2021 due to supply chain disruptions caused by pandemic-related lockdowns and shortages in ethylene and propylene feedstocks, the primary raw materials used to manufacture glycol. 

By 2021, prices had risen to approximately $1,120/MT, representing a 17.9% increase from the previous year. This spike was largely driven by delays in chemical production and increased logistics costs, particularly in ocean freight. Additionally, heightened regulatory scrutiny on the environmental impact of deicing chemicals in North America and Europe prompted manufacturers to invest in cleaner production technologies, marginally increasing overhead costs. 

The year 2022 saw some stabilization, with prices averaging $1,050/MT due to improved supply chains and slightly milder winter conditions in some key regions. However, demand remained firm in Northern and Eastern Europe, and parts of Canada, maintaining overall market balance. 

In 2023, a colder-than-expected winter season across several regions triggered a demand surge, resulting in another price hike. Prices reached an average of $1,180/MT. This increase was compounded by rising energy costs, particularly in Europe, where gas and electricity prices remained high throughout the winter months, impacting production efficiency and cost structures. 

The Glycol-Based Deicing Solutions price news in 2024 indicated further volatility. A combination of geopolitical tensions and transportation bottlenecks, especially in key ports, disrupted the steady flow of glycol feedstocks. This led to a temporary price peak of $1,270/MT during Q1 2024, though prices fell to around $1,200/MT by the end of the year as logistical conditions improved and new suppliers entered the market. 

As of 2025, the average global price for Glycol-Based Deicing Solutions ranges between $1,230 and $1,300/MT. This increase is attributed to both higher demand in colder regions and rising production costs, especially for ethylene glycol-based variants. Additionally, the environmental compliance costs have added pressure on manufacturers, particularly in North America, where stricter regulations are now being enforced. 

The Glycol-Based Deicing Solutions price trend has also been affected by the shift toward environmentally safer formulations. Many producers are moving away from traditional glycol types toward more biodegradable alternatives. These alternatives, although less harmful to the environment, tend to be more expensive to produce and distribute, pushing the average Glycol-Based Deicing Solutions price news higher. 

Other notable drivers of price movements over the past five years include: 

  • Seasonal demand surges in Q4 and Q1 each year, especially in aviation hubs 
  • Changes in Glycol-Based Deicing Solutions production efficiency due to fuel and labor costs 
  • International trade policies affecting the import and export of glycol derivatives 
  • Shifts in consumer preferences toward safer and less corrosive deicing options 

The global Glycol-Based Deicing Solutions sales volume has increased by roughly 20% since 2020, reflecting broader winterization strategies in infrastructure and aviation industries. The supply-demand dynamic remains relatively tight, which continues to influence price behavior in the market.

Global Glycol-Based Deicing Solutions Import-Export Business Overview  

The global trade of Glycol-Based Deicing Solutions has expanded significantly over the last few years, fueled by growing safety regulations and infrastructure investments in cold-climate regions. In 2025, the Glycol-Based Deicing Solutions import-export market is marked by several key developments, including diversification of supply chains, increased exports from Asia, and rising imports into North America and Europe. 

North America remains the largest consumer and importer of Glycol-Based Deicing Solutions. The United States, in particular, imports substantial quantities during Q3 and Q4 in preparation for winter. While domestic production meets a significant portion of demand, regional shortages and fluctuations in glycol feedstock availability result in periodic import spikes from Canada, South Korea, and Germany. Canada, meanwhile, maintains a dual role as both exporter and importer, depending on its internal demand and inventory levels. 

In Europe, import volumes are heavily influenced by weather conditions and environmental regulations. Germany, France, and the UK lead in consumption, with most imports coming from Eastern Europe and Asia. In 2025, several European countries expanded their contracts with South Korean and Japanese manufacturers to secure more environmentally friendly deicing solutions. At the same time, intra-European trade has grown, particularly from Poland and Hungary, where production capacities have increased due to recent investments. 

Asia-Pacific has emerged as a major exporter in the Glycol-Based Deicing Solutions market. China, India, and South Korea have increased their production capacities, leveraging cost-effective labor and abundant feedstock supply. These countries are exporting high volumes to Europe, North America, and even parts of the Middle East. In 2025, South Korean exports rose by 18%, driven by new bilateral agreements and improved logistics infrastructure. 

China’s role in the global market is particularly noteworthy. Despite facing environmental scrutiny, Chinese manufacturers have improved the quality of their Glycol-Based Deicing Solutions, making them more competitive globally. This has resulted in growing exports to both Western Europe and South America, where demand is increasing due to infrastructure development in high-altitude regions. 

Latin America and Africa, though not major producers, have shown increasing demand for Glycol-Based Deicing Solutions, especially in mountainous and high-altitude zones. Chile, Argentina, and South Africa have reported steady year-over-year growth in imports, primarily from Asia. These regions are also becoming viable transit markets for logistics firms aiming to diversify supply chains. 

In 2025, the international trade dynamics are also being shaped by: 

  • Trade tariffs and chemical import regulations in the EU and US 
  • Advancements in packaging and shelf-stability, allowing longer storage of products 
  • Expansion of free trade agreements favoring chemical and industrial product movement 
  • Investment in port infrastructure in key export hubs like Busan, Shanghai, and Rotterdam 

Glycol-Based Deicing Solutions production has increased in Asia, with new plants being commissioned in India and Indonesia. These developments aim to cater to both regional demand and international markets, potentially shifting trade balances in the next few years. The increase in capacity has also affected the global Glycol-Based Deicing Solutions Price Trend, slightly easing pressure on global prices during off-peak quarters. 

Environmental compliance remains a key trade factor. Regions with strict environmental laws prefer importing certified, eco-friendly solutions, which narrows down the list of acceptable exporters. Producers in North America and Northern Europe are at an advantage here, offering low-toxicity and biodegradable solutions that meet stringent criteria. 

In conclusion, 2025 has seen the Glycol-Based Deicing Solutions sales volume increase globally, backed by steady growth in infrastructure investments and harsher winter patterns. The import-export landscape continues to shift, driven by regional production capabilities, environmental regulations, and evolving customer preferences.

Glycol-Based Deicing Solutions Production Trends by Geography 

The production of Glycol-Based Deicing Solutions is geographically concentrated in regions with strong chemical manufacturing infrastructure, access to raw materials, and proximity to key cold-climate markets. As of 2025, major production centers are located in North America, Europe, and Asia-Pacific, with increasing activity observed in emerging regions such as Eastern Europe and Southeast Asia. These geographies not only serve domestic markets but also play a crucial role in international trade and export of Glycol-Based Deicing Solutions. 

North America 

North America remains one of the most prominent producers of Glycol-Based Deicing Solutions, driven by strong demand in the aviation and transportation sectors. The United States, in particular, has a mature chemical manufacturing base that supports the production of both ethylene and propylene glycol-based deicers. Facilities in the Midwest and Northeastern states are strategically located close to major airports and transportation hubs, allowing for efficient supply during peak winter months. 

Canada also contributes significantly to regional production. With its cold climate and long winters, domestic production supports both local use and exports to the northern U.S. provinces. Canadian manufacturers often focus on producing environmentally safer variants, in line with the country’s strict environmental regulations. 

Europe 

Europe is a major hub for Glycol-Based Deicing Solutions production, especially in Germany, Poland, the Netherlands, and Scandinavia. Germany leads in technological innovation and sustainability in deicing fluid production. The country’s chemical sector has embraced advancements in low-toxicity, biodegradable formulations, making its products favorable in international markets. 

Poland and Hungary have expanded their production capacities in recent years, focusing on cost-efficient manufacturing to supply both Eastern and Western Europe. These countries benefit from strong logistics networks and EU integration, enabling smooth trade flow. 

The Nordic countries, particularly Sweden and Finland, produce specialized deicing fluids designed to operate in extremely cold environments. These solutions are engineered for performance at lower temperatures and are increasingly exported to North America and parts of Russia. 

Asia-Pacific 

Asia-Pacific has become a high-growth region in terms of Glycol-Based Deicing Solutions production. China, South Korea, and India are the primary contributors. China leads in overall production volume due to its low-cost labor, abundant access to chemical feedstocks, and government incentives for industrial expansion. While environmental concerns have led to some operational scrutiny, Chinese manufacturers are gradually shifting toward greener production methods. 

South Korea’s chemical industry is known for high-quality output, and its glycol-based deicing fluids are increasingly preferred in European and North American markets. Korean manufacturers have invested in R&D to produce eco-friendly, performance-driven solutions. 

India, although a relatively new entrant in the market, is rapidly expanding its production facilities. With growing expertise in specialty chemicals and increasing demand from international clients, Indian companies are eyeing markets in the Middle East and Africa. 

Latin America 

While Latin America is not a significant producer of Glycol-Based Deicing Solutions, there is growing interest in localized production in countries such as Chile and Argentina. These nations have high-altitude regions that require seasonal deicing, and some manufacturers are exploring small-scale production units to serve regional demand. 

Middle East and Africa 

Production in the Middle East and Africa is minimal. However, nations like South Africa are beginning to evaluate the feasibility of manufacturing Glycol-Based Deicing Solutions locally, especially to cater to mining and high-altitude transport sectors. Most of the supply in this region is still met through imports, primarily from Europe and Asia. 

Emerging Trends 

Globally, there is a clear trend toward more environmentally sustainable production. Manufacturers across all major regions are investing in greener formulations, closed-loop production systems, and recycling processes to meet regulatory requirements and growing consumer expectations. 

Another trend is decentralization. Instead of relying solely on mega production hubs, companies are setting up satellite production and blending facilities closer to demand centers. This strategy reduces transportation costs and enables quicker response to weather-related demand surges. 

In summary, the global production of Glycol-Based Deicing Solutions is shaped by regional strengths, environmental policies, raw material access, and export potential. North America and Europe remain leaders in technology and sustainable practices, while Asia-Pacific continues to dominate in volume and cost efficiency.

Explanation of Leading Segments 

The Glycol-Based Deicing Solutions market is diverse, with several key segments showing notable growth and adoption. Among these, the leading segments by product type, application, and end-user offer a clear view of where the market is heading. 

By Product Type: Ethylene and Propylene Glycol-Based Solutions 

Ethylene glycol-based deicers are the most widely used due to their lower production cost and high performance in freezing conditions. However, due to their toxicity, their use is more common in controlled environments like large airports with proper wastewater management systems. These products dominate in regions with cold climates and mature infrastructure. 

Propylene glycol-based deicers are gaining popularity due to their lower environmental impact. Though slightly more expensive to produce, their use is increasing in regions with strict environmental regulations. For instance, municipal and public sector buyers in Europe often prefer these solutions for road deicing. Blended formulations, which combine the best of both types, are used in areas requiring customized performance and safety profiles. 

By Application: Aviation and Road Transportation 

The aviation sector is the largest application segment. Airports require large volumes of Glycol-Based Deicing Solutions, especially during Q4 and Q1, when snow and ice accumulation can ground flights. The consistent demand from global and regional airports sustains this segment year-round, with many entering long-term supply agreements with manufacturers. 

Road transportation is the second most significant application area. Municipalities and highway agencies use these solutions extensively to maintain road safety. In 2025, increased government spending on infrastructure maintenance and extreme weather preparedness is fueling this segment’s growth. 

Railways also use deicing fluids, though to a lesser extent. Their use is typically limited to switches and crossings in colder regions. The commercial and residential infrastructure segment is still emerging, mainly driven by property management firms in high-latitude cities. 

By End User: Airports and Highway Maintenance Agencies 

Airports and airlines are the top end users of Glycol-Based Deicing Solutions. Major hubs such as those in Chicago, Toronto, Frankfurt, and Seoul maintain contracts with suppliers to ensure uninterrupted winter operations. This segment values high performance, fast-acting deicers with minimal corrosion. 

Highway maintenance agencies form another critical user group. With public safety as a top priority, these agencies procure deicing fluids in bulk before winter seasons. The push for greener solutions has led many of them to switch from salt-based deicers to glycol-based alternatives, especially in environmentally sensitive zones. 

Railway operators and municipal authorities follow as key users, especially in Europe and Canada, where railway traffic is extensive. Facility managers at industrial plants, data centers, and hospitals in snowy regions also contribute to niche but growing demand. 

By Distribution Channel: Direct Sales and Distributors 

The most common distribution channel remains direct sales, particularly for large contracts in aviation and government sectors. Direct sales allow customization, bulk pricing, and long-term logistics planning. Distributors cater to smaller municipalities and commercial clients, offering ready-to-use variants and smaller packaging sizes. 

Online retail is still a minor channel but is gaining momentum for residential and light commercial applications. Companies offering ready-made deicing products through digital platforms are expanding into Northern U.S. and European markets. 

By Region: North America and Europe Lead 

North America leads the market, driven by large-scale use in both aviation and transportation sectors. The U.S. and Canada together account for a significant share of the global Glycol-Based Deicing Solutions sales volume. 

Europe is a close second, particularly in countries like Germany, Sweden, and the UK. The strict environmental framework in Europe pushes demand for propylene-based and eco-friendly variants. 

Asia-Pacific is rapidly growing, with China and South Korea both major producers and consumers. The domestic demand is rising, but the region’s export capability gives it a dual advantage. 

In conclusion, the Glycol-Based Deicing Solutions market is evolving with clear leadership in aviation and municipal use, strong growth in propylene glycol adoption, and a steady shift toward environmentally compliant production and application.
